How Virtual Medical Scribes Support Remote Care
A virtual medical scribe assists physicians by documenting patient encounters in real time during virtual or in-person visits. These professionals ensure that clinical notes are accurate, complete, and entered promptly into EHR systems. By reducing the documentation burden, virtual scribes allow physicians to focus more on patient interaction and clinical decision-making, which is especially important in remote healthcare settings.
The Connection Between Accurate Documentation and Coding
High-quality documentation directly impacts billing and reimbursement. Many healthcare organizations integrate documentation services with virtual medical coding to ensure that diagnoses and procedures are coded correctly. Virtual coders rely on detailed clinical notes prepared by scribes, helping reduce claim denials and maintain compliance with healthcare regulations.
